Temper will likely be recognized by microscopic evaluation of the tempered material. Clay identification is determined by a process of refiring the ceramic and assigning a shade to it using Munsell Soil Color notation. By estimating both the clay and temper compositions and locating a area where by each are acknowledged to manifest, an assignment from the material supply might be made. Dependant on the source assignment from the artifact, more investigations is often made into the internet site of manufacture.

Whilst pottery fragments are already observed nearly 19,000 decades aged, it wasn't right until about ten,000 decades afterwards that common pottery turned prevalent. An early persons that unfold across Significantly of Europe is named right after its use of pottery: the Corded Ware culture. These early Indo-European peoples decorated their pottery by wrapping it with rope while it had been even now damp. In the event the ceramics were fired, the rope burned off but left a attractive pattern of complicated grooves on the area.

Hydroxyapatite, the key mineral part of bone, has become made synthetically from various Organic and chemical elements and may be formed into ceramic materials. Orthopedic implants coated Using these materials bond quickly to bone and various tissues in the human body devoid of rejection or inflammatory reaction. They may be of excellent interest for gene supply and tissue engineering scaffolding. Most hydroxyapatite ceramics are rather porous and absence mechanical strength and they are thus utilised exclusively to coat metallic orthopedic products to aid in forming a bond to bone or as bone fillers.
